The Role of a CNA in Ponca City OK

cna with patient in Ponca City OK nursing homeCertified Nursing Assistants perform many functions in the Ponca City OK hospitals, clinics and other healthcare organizations where they are employed. Per their title, CNAs are not licensed by the state but rather are certified. Because they are not licensed, they perform under the direction and oversight of either a licensed LPN or RN. And as nursing assistants, their prime job duty is to aid the licensed nurses that they work under. Their duties are numerous and diverse, and in a hospital environment can include:

  • Providing basic care to patients
  • Checking patient’s vital signs
  • Maintaining a record of patient’s health status
  • Cleaning and dressing patients
  • Serving and helping patients with meals
  • Moving patients to other areas

CNAs might also work in Ponca City OK nursing homes or long term care facilities. In those settings, nursing assistants are more involved in assisting patients with their Activities of Daily Living (ADL). ADLs are characterized as routine activities that the majority of people carry out daily without aid, for example eating, dressing, or using the washroom. Nursing assistants commonly develop more of a bond with these patients since they usually reside in the facilities for extensive time periods. In many cases, they can become the pipeline between the patient and the rest of the medical staff due to their familiarity with their charges. As a result, the CNA’s knowledge can be a beneficial resource for planning the appropriate care and treatment of long term care patients.

CNA Courses

Unlike some other licensed nurses, certified nursing assistants in Ponca City OK do not need to earn a college degree. CNA instruction can be obtained at a community college or at either a vocational or trade school. The length of the training program can take anywhere from 1 to three months, resulting in either a certificate or a diploma. Within the 1987 Nursing Home Reform Act, students are mandated to have at least 75 hours of instruction, 16 of which need to be clinical or “hands-on” training hours. Keep in mind that this is the minimum amount of training mandated and every state has its own requirements. So it’s necessary to make certain that the course you enroll in not only satisfies the federal requirements, but also those for the state where you will be practicing. One suggestion is to check with the health or nursing board for your state to make sure that the education is state certified. In addition to the training, each state mandates a passing score on a competency test for certification. Depending on the state, there might be additional requirements as well.

Is the CNA program accredited?  It’s important that the Ponca City OK school and program that you enroll in is accredited.  One of the more highly regarded accrediting authorities is the National League for Nursing Accrediting Commission (NLNAC).  CNA schools and programs that have been accredited by the NLNAC are guaranteed to not only provide a quality education but to be state approved as well.  Earning a certificate or diploma from an accredited school is also more likely to be credited towards a more advanced nursing degree at another accredited school.  And finally, accreditation makes your training more valuable in the job market.

Is the CNA course state approved?  Before enrolling in a training course near Ponca City OK, make sure that it complies with the certification requirements for Oklahoma or the state where you will be practicing.  It should not only satisfy the minimum federal requirement of 75 hours, 16 of which must be clinical training, but any additional state requirements as well.  As previously mentioned, if the CNA course is accredited by NLNAC it will be guaranteed to be state approved.

What is the Pass Rate for the State Exam?  It’s preferable to enroll in a nursing assistant school near Ponca City OK with a pass rate for the state licensing exam of at least 75% for its graduates.  If fewer than 75% are passing, it may be an indication that the curriculum and/or the instructors are not effectively training the students.  Oklahoma posts a list of state CNA schools with their state licensing exam pass rates.

Is there an Internship Program?  Find out if the schools you are considering sponsor internships with Ponca City OK healthcare facilities.  They are a great way to get hands-on clinical experience not available in a classroom or lab setting.  As an additional benefit, they can help students establish relationships within the local medical community.  They also look good on resumes.  Also check to see if tutoring is available as needed.  Other options may include an internet school forum or chat room where students can ask questions and share knowledge.

Is there a Job Placement Program?  A job placement program can be of great assistance to a graduating student in finding that first nursing position.  Find out how many students are being placed in jobs with the assistance of the school.  If a school has a high job placement rate, it’s a confirmation that its reputation within the Ponca City OK medical community is exemplary.  It also confirms that the school has a broad network of contacts to assist students gain internships or employment after graduation.

Where is the school located?  The campus will need to be within driving distance of your Ponca City OK residence unless you are able to relocate.  If you enroll in an online program, find out where the clinical portion of your training is available.  If a school has an internship program, most likely the placements will be within its local area.  Also keep in mind that if you enroll in an out-of-state school, or even out of area for many community colleges, the tuition costs as a non-resident may be higher.

How large are the classes?  Ask the schools you are considering on average how large their classes are.  Smaller classes usually provide more access to teachers when students have questions or need extra help.  In contrast, larger classes tend to be more impersonal and limit one-on-one instruction.  If practical, find out if you can monitor a couple of the classes before enrolling so that you can experience the level of interaction between students and instructors.

What is the Program’s total cost?  CNA training and tuition can vary not only among schools, but from state to state depending on certification requirements.  In addition to tuition, there are other costs such as commuting expenses, textbooks and other materials.  When comparing schools remember to include all costs required for your education.  If you do decide to attend an online school, some of the expenses may be reduced.  Most schools have financial aid departments, so be sure to find out what is available in the Ponca City OK area.

Can the Program accommodate your Schedule?  Finally, you will need to make sure that the program you select offers classes at a time that you can attend.  If you are still working and need to attend classes at night or on weekends near Ponca City OK, make sure they are available.  If you can only attend part-time, make sure that is an option as well.  Even if you have decided to attend classes online, you will still need to confirm when clinical training hours are offered.  Also, find out what the policy is for making up classes should you miss any due to work, illness or other obligations.

Ponca City, Oklahoma

Ponca City was created in 1893 as New Ponca after the United States opened the Cherokee Outlet for European-American settlement during the Cherokee Strip land run, the largest land run in United States history.[1] The site for Ponca City was selected for its proximity to the Arkansas River and the presence of a fresh water spring near the river. The city was laid out by Burton Barnes, who drew up the first survey of the city and sold certificates for the lots he had surveyed. After the drawing for lots in the city was completed, Barnes was elected the city's first mayor.[4]

Another city, Cross, vied with Ponca City to become the leading city in the area. After the Atchison, Topeka and Santa Fe Railway had opened a station in Cross, people thought it would not open another in Ponca City because of the two cities' proximity.[4] New Ponca boosters eventually secured a station after offering the Santa Fe station agent two town lots and the free relocation of his house from Cross.[5] Ponca City reportedly obtained its first boxcar station by some Ponca City supporters going to Cross and returning with the town's station pulled behind them.[4] Cross eventually became defunct. In 1913 New Ponca changed its name to Ponca City.[5]

Ponca City's history and economy has been shaped chiefly by the ebb and flow of the petroleum industry. E. W. Marland, a Pennsylvania oil man, came to Oklahoma and founded the Marland Oil Company, which once controlled approximately 10 percent of the world's oil reserves.[6] He founded the 101 Ranch Oil Company, located on the Miller Brothers 101 Ranch, and drilled his first successful oil well on land which he leased in 1911 from the Ponca Tribe of American Indians.[7] He was elected in 1932 as a U.S. congressman and in 1934 as governor of Oklahoma.
